What is astaxanthin and why is it important?

Astaxanthin is part of the group of carotenoids, natural pigments synthesized by plants, algae and bacteria.

As I mentioned, astaxanthin has high antioxidant properties , making it very effective in protecting our body from the presence of high levels of free radicals, which cause chronic health problems and various hair and skin problems.

What are free radicals and oxidative stress?

Free radicals are unstable molecules naturally present in our body , highly reactive and that attack the protein bonds of tissues, cell membranes and nucleic acids of cells , causing cell death .

The set of free radicals that have this capacity to produce oxidative damage are called reactive oxygen species (ROS, according to the acronym in English for Reactive Oxygen Species).

ROS are products of normal metabolism, that is, they are part of cellular functioning and are present at low and steady levels in normal cells. However, ROS can cause irreversible damage to DNA, as they oxidize and modify some cellular components and prevent them from performing their functions.

The problem would come from the drastic increase in ROS levels , either due to its increased production or a decrease in its elimination. High levels of ROS can result in significant damage to cellular structures , a phenomenon known as oxidative stress. In other words, oxidative stress occurs when the balance between the production of reactive oxygen species and antioxidant defense mechanisms is broken , leading to a variety of physiological and biochemical changes that cause cell deterioration and death.

Antioxidants would, therefore, be molecules capable of neutralizing ROS , delaying or inhibiting cellular damage.

How does oxidative stress influence hair and skin?

Hair is continually exposed to different aggressors such as sunlight, pollution, heat and cosmetic treatments . All of these factors are harmful to the hair as they can trigger the formation of excessive free radicals. This can lead, in turn, to an alteration of the natural metabolic pathway of the hair growth cycle and a greater possibility of hair loss.

For its part, in the skin, oxidative stress contributes to premature aging , compromising not only its protective function, but also contributing to the appearance of excessive dryness and itching, a greater predisposition to the formation or deepening of wrinkles, and alterations in pigmentation, fragility and difficulty healing , skin irritation and even an increased risk of skin cancer.

How does astaxanthin contribute to the health of our hair and skin?

Being an antioxidant product, the beneficial effects of astaxanthin are related to the unique properties of its molecular structure that allow it to eliminate reactive species and, in this way, cope with oxidative stress that can be harmful to our cells.

It has been reported in some studies that astaxanthin improves skin health by influencing different stages of the oxidative stress cascade, while inhibiting some inflammatory mediators.

On the other hand, the effects of astaxanthin on the prevention of hyperpigmentation and the prevention of premature photoaging have also been reported in clinical studies .

Where can we find astaxanthin?

Astaxanthin is predominantly found in marine microorganisms and animals . It is responsible for the well-known orange-red color of the skin and meat of shrimp, crayfish and salmon. Crustaceans and fish cannot synthesize astaxanthin, therefore they depend on the supply of astaxanthin precursors through the consumption of algae such as Haematococcus pluvialis and other microorganisms.

Likewise, humans cannot synthesize carotenoids and must obtain them from the diet. The main sources of astaxanthin for humans are salmon (with wild sockeye salmon containing the highest amount of astaxanthin) or rainbow trout . Other natural sources of astaxanthin are green algae, some mushrooms, krill, shrimp, lobsters or crabs.
